I’m not NDC or NPP Speaker – Alban Bagbin

The Speaker of Parliament, Rt Honorable Alban Bagbin has said that the office of the speaker is not a partisan or political office.

According Bagbin, irrespective of him being nominated and elected by a political party, he owes no allegiance to them as a speaker of parliament.

Speaking on the floor of parliament during the first sitting of the 8th parliament since inception, Bagbin said “The speaker is not a partisan political office: regardless of which party nominated or elected him or her and regardless of his or her previous political background. The speaker of parliament of Ghana is a non partisan, impartial office. There is no NDC or NPP speaker but only the speaker of the Republic of Ghana.”

He however charged the MPs to be of good behavior and that he will work professionally devoid of any political party color.

The Speaker is expected to douse the tension that has arisen between the NPP and the NDC Members of Parliament in the House.

This comes after the NDC caucus dismissed assertions by the colleagues from the governing party that the NPP lawmakers are the majority side following the decision of the Fomena Independent MP to do business with them.

Earlier today pictures from the House showed NPP MPs who were taking a nap as they waited for the Speaker of the House and MPs from the NDC side.

Both the NDC and the NPP have 137 seats in Parliament with one Independent MP.

The Independent MP, Asiamah Amoako has, however, indicated to the Speaker of Parliament that he will do business with the NPP caucus.
